I was hurt in an Uber or Lyft in Lansing — who pays?
It depends on what the driver was doing at the time, and rideshare companies carry large insurance policies that can apply. We sort out which coverage is on the hook so you don't have to.
Does it matter if I was the passenger, another driver, or a pedestrian?
No — you may have a claim in any of those roles. The key is acting before the details get muddy.
